Learning Objectives

Students will be able to identify how many letters are in their names.

Introduction

(5 minutes)
  • Write your name on the whiteboard or chart paper.
  • Ask the students if they know how many letters are in your name.

Beginning

  • Review counting 1–20 using songs, stories, or games.
  • Allow students to count in their home language (L1).

Intermediate

  • Have students turn and talk to a partner to answer the question, "How can I count the letters in my name?"
